On Primary Election Night in Illinois, WCPT hosts Joan Esposito, Patti Vasquez, and Richard Chew were on the air between 7:00 and 10:30 p.m. Central Tuesday with special guests, live updates from our reporters, candidate call-ins, and the important speeches as they happened.
Guests included:
- U.S. Rep. Mike Quigley (D-IL)
- Jacob Kaplan, executive director of the Cook County Democratic Party
- Max Bever, director of Public Information for the Chicago Board of Election
- Lisa Hernandez, chair of the Democratic Party of Illinois and member of the Illinois House of Representatives
- Jill Wine-Banks, legal analyst and pundit
- Peter Giangreco, Democratic strategist, partner at The Strategy Group
- Aaron Kleinman, head of research at Heartland Signal
- U.S. Rep. Robin Kelly, candidate for U.S. Senate in Illinois
- Chicago Alders Matt Martin and Timmy Knudsen
- Illinois State Reps Kam Buckner and Rick Ryan
- Precious Brady Davis, commissioner of the Metropolitan Water Reclamation District of Greater Chicago
- Illinois Attorney General Kwame Raoul
- Dovile Cather, Juliana Stratton campaign manager
Our on-location reporters were:
- Ken Mejia-Beal (frequent fill-in host and guest co-host on “Driving It Home” and “Out Chicago”) from Daniel Biss HQ
- Matt Byrne (WCPT producer) from Melissa Bean HQ
- Paul Chivari (WCPT producer) from Raja Krishnamoorthi HQ
- Steve Lessman (WCPT sales manager) from Margaret Croke HQ
- Ellen Miller (co-host of “Out Chicago,” Sundays from 11: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. on WCPT) from Juliana Stratton HQ
- Dylan Olthoff (WCPT producer) from Sen. Robert Peters HQ
- Whitney Randall (WCPT intern) from Robin Kelly HQ
